How is background verification carried out in the process of hiring personnel in the field of scientific research in Guatemala?

In scientific research in Guatemala, background checks may include review of research projects, scientific publications, and certifications in specific areas of science. This is essential to guarantee the competence and credibility of professionals in the scientific field.

How are cases of loss of identity documents handled in Colombia in validation processes?

In cases of lost identity documents in Colombia, procedures have been established to address identity validation. This may include filing complaints with relevant authorities and using alternative methods, such as verification using additional personal information, to confirm the identity of individuals in validation processes.

What happens if a company in Peru discovers that it has entered into a transaction with a sanctioned entity or individual without intention?

If a company in Peru discovers that it has unintentionally entered into a transaction with a sanctioned entity or individual, it must take immediate steps to remedy the situation, inform the relevant authorities and cooperate in the investigation. Transparency and cooperation are essential in such cases.

What are the obligations of financial institutions in Costa Rica to prevent the financing of terrorism?

Financial institutions in Costa Rica have the obligation to implement robust measures to prevent the financing of terrorism. This includes due diligence in identifying customers, monitoring suspicious transactions and reporting unusual transactions to the relevant authorities. The Law to Strengthen the Fight against Terrorism establishes specific requirements for these institutions to implement prevention programs, staff training and communication channels with the authorities. Compliance with these obligations is essential to strengthen the integrity of the financial system and prevent its misuse for terrorist activities.

What happens if my judicial record in Peru contains confidential information that may put my security at risk?

If your judicial records in Peru contain confidential information that may put your security at risk, it is essential to communicate with the competent authorities. You can submit a request for certain data to be treated confidentially or restricted, especially if it involves sensitive situations, such as sexual crimes or domestic violence. The authorities will evaluate your situation and take the necessary measures to protect your security and privacy.

What is the process to apply for a tourist visa for Mexico if I am a citizen of a country that does not require a visa?

If you are a citizen of a country whose citizens do not require a visa to enter Mexico as a tourist, you only need to present a valid passport. It is not necessary to apply for a prior visa. You can stay as a tourist for a set period, usually 180 days.
